crisco = stuck rotor seals?

i had this in my rebuild thread but didn't get responses.

what i did was install the side and corner seals by laying down crisco in the grooves first. they've been sitting like this for 4 months, now the crisco has become dried and gunky. do i need to clean it out and re-install the seals? or is this change typical of assembled rotors/engines that will not have ill effects?
